us open logo 14Consider this post day two of my personal journey to Pinehurst and the U. S. Open Championships. After a hectic day one of an eleven hour drive I finally got to Pinehurst and the media center about 4:00pm.

Today’s press conference schedule is jam packed and I plan on attending the Architecture Forum which includes Mike Davis and Bill Coore and Ben Crenshaw.

Today I had a chance meeting with Rand Jerris of the USGA.

Dr. Jerris is the Senior Director of Public Services which encompasses the Green Section, communications, facilities, philanthropic activities, diversity, operation and most avidly the USGA Museum.

I complimented Dr. Jerris on the museum and how it is a hidden gem in Far Hills and he agreed. He said the museum was indeed his passion and we both agreed that any golf fan should spend some time there.
